    8yr old Basset wont go in the crate anymore.........

    My wifes mother crates both of her Basset Hounds every night around 9PM.  This has been an on-going routine for about 6 years now.  Within the last 2 months the one Basset just refuses to go into the crate.  He will bark, growl (hasnt attempted to bite) and do whatever it takes to not go in the crate.  Any advice on what could possibly have changed this dog's mind about going in the crate???

    An 8 y/o basset may be getting touches of arthritis or some other type of pain that is made worse by not being able to stretch out or move around. It may just hurt him to lay in there all night.
